A proven choice for industrial professionals, this 0.757-inch thick 316 stainless steel stock sheet measures 26 inches in length and 28 inches in width. Engineered from austenitic chromium-nickel stainless steel with molybdenum, it provides superior resistance to pitting and crevice corrosion in chloride-rich environments, making it ideal for marine, chemical processing, and harsh outdoor applications. Its high tensile strength and formability allow for custom fabrication and reliable structural integrity in demanding suspending and bracing systems.

| Tensile Strength | 75,000 psi (515 MPa) |
| Yield Strength | 30,000 psi (205 MPa) |
| Elongation in 2 in. | 40% min |
| Hardness | Rockwell B95 max |
| Carbon (C) | 0.08% max |
| Chromium (Cr) | 16.0 - 18.0% |
| Nickel (Ni) | 10.0 - 14.0% |
| Molybdenum (Mo) | 2.0 - 3.0% |
